Urumqi Air accepts its first C909 — milestone for China’s regional jet programme

Urumqi Air has taken delivery of the first C909, a milestone for the Chinese aircraft programme. The handover represents a visible commercial placement of the domestically built regional jet and underscores progress in the C909’s certification and production pathway to entry into service.

  • The handover is a tangible commercial placement for COMAC’s C909, adding to recent programme activity such as a prior C909 delivery configured for air medical rescue and commercial interest from carriers — see COMAC’s earlier C909 delivery and the Air Cambodia memorandum of understanding.

  • The delivery advances China’s effort to field domestically built regional jets and informs fleet planning and sourcing decisions across Asia; it follows COMAC’s broader push to showcase its narrowbodies and court export customers at events such as the Dubai Airshow.
